The student to faculty ratio at National University is about average at 16 to 1. This ratio is often used to gauge how many students might be in an average class and how much time professors will have to spend with their students on an individual level. The national average for this metric is 15 to 1.
When estimating how much access students will have to their teachers, some people like to look at what percentage of faculty members are full time. This is because part-time teachers may not have as much time to spend on campus as their full-time counterparts.
The full-time faculty percentage at National University is 11%. This is lower than the national average of 47%.
The freshmen retention rate is a sign of how many full-time students like a college or university well enough to come back for their sophomore year. At National University this rate is 54%, which is a bit lower than the national average of 68%.
Students are considered to have graduated on time if they finish their studies within four years. At National University the on-time graduation rate of first-time, full-time students is 50%. That is great when compared to the national average of 33.3%.

The typical net cost at National University is $16,772.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id. Note that the net price is typically less than the published price for a school. It’s not uncommon for college students to take out loans to pay for school. In fact, almost 66% of students nationwide depend at least partially on loans. At National University, approximately 25% of students took out student loans averaging $8,350 a year. That adds up to $33,400 over four years for those students. The student loan default rate is 5.1%. This is significantly lower than the national default rate of 10.1%, which is a good sign that you’ll be able to pay back your student loans. The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or’s degree from National University make about $67,548 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. This is good news for future National University graduates since it is 37% more than the average college graduate’s salary of $49,219 per year.

During the most recent year for which we have data, students from 22 majors graduated from National University. The following table lists the most popular undergraduate majors along with the average salary graduates from those majors make.
| Most Popular Majors | Completions | Average Salary of Graduates |
|---|---|---|
| Multi-Disciplinary Studies | 5,851 | NA |
| Clinical & Counseling Psychology | 1,111 | $55,141 |
| General Education | 779 | $58,901 |
| Business Administration & Management | 576 | $59,552 |
| Nursing | 376 | $86,288 |
| Special Education | 352 | $62,820 |
| General Psychology | 261 | $40,096 |
| Security Science and Technology. | 163 | NA |
| Teacher Education Grade Specific | 147 | $43,389 |
| Criminal Justice & Corrections | 140 | $51,920 |
